Re: [ZWeb] Error Type, IOError, Error Value, [Errno 28] No space left on device
-BEGIN PGP SIGNED MESSAGE- Hash: SHA1 Jens Vagelpohl wrote: On Aug 6, 2009, at 09:43 , Andreas Jung wrote: Same issue this morning. This must be fixed soon - otherwise we can not proceed with the releases. I just looked and for some strange reason the ZODB has grown to over 30 GB, which means it more than doubled in size since the last full backup on August 2. Looking at the backup files from repozo it appears the massive growth happened over the last few days, those daily incrementals since August 2 range from 5-6 GB in size each. I have now freed up 3 GB by deleting the remaining delta files from the previous round of backups, but this may not be enough seeing how fast the database is growing. Something fishy is going on. Hi, this was caused by spamming 2 collector issues in member space, each holding a transcript of about 1 MB and more. I removed the issues, blocked the spamming user account and finally changed default roles for everything collector related to 'Manager'. -BEGIN PGP SIGNED MESSAGE- Hash: SHA1 Christian Theune wrote: On Wed, 2009-03-18 at 13:12 +0100, Michael Haubenwallner wrote: -BEGIN PGP SIGNED MESSAGE- Hash: SHA1 Michael Haubenwallner wrote: When using paste.httpserver instead of twisted.wsgi server zope.publisher.xmlrpc.XMLRPCRequest.processInputs() hangs when reading 0 Bytes from the request (wsgi.input socket._fileobject object). As i found the zope.publisher.http.HTTPInputStream.readlines() signature was changed 3 years ago from readlines(self, hint=None) to readlines(self, hint=0) http://svn.zope.org/Zope3/trunk/src/zope/publisher/http.py?rev=66941r1=66940r2=66941 Do you think we could revert the change? Bugs reported: zopeproject: https://bugs.launchpad.net/zope3/+bug/283089 grokproject: https://bugs.launchpad.net/grok/+bug/332063 Bump - maybe my description was too complicated, but the issue is serious: XMLRPC is broken at least with paste.httpserver Any input on the implications of reverting the change in revision #66941? I've looked at the various APIs of actual objects that need to consume the size hint parameter (cStringIO, StringIO, file, socket._fileobject). All of them should be fine getting a 0 as an argument, but file and cStringIO will break if they get `None` instead of 0: Type| readlines() | readlines(None) | readlines(0) +-+-+-- file| works | TypeError | works StringIO| works | works | works cStringIO | works | TypeError | works socket._fileobject [1]_ | works | works | works .. [1] I've only looked at the code and reasoned about this. What I'm puzzled about is that the commit message of 66491 mentions compatibility to StringIO but that would have worked just fine with `None`. So this either actually means compatibility with file or compatibility with cStringIO. Nevertheless: passing in 0 seems to be the safe bet in general and I wonder what is actually breaking. I haven't seen a traceback be attached at either bug. Also, those bugs should probably be marked as duplicates. You are right, looking at the problem again i suggest to add this change to zope.publisher.xmlrpc - --- src/zope/publisher/xmlrpc.py (revision 100356) +++ src/zope/publisher/xmlrpc.py(working copy) @@ -46,10 +46,14 @@ 'See IPublisherRequest' # Parse the request XML structure - -# XXX using readlines() instead of lines() - -# as twisted's BufferedStream sends back - -# an empty stream here for read() (bug) - -lines = ''.join(self._body_instream.readlines()) +# XXX using readline() instead of readlines() +# as readlines() is not working with +# paster.httpserver +line = 1 +lines = '' +while line != '': +line = self._body_instream.readline() +lines += line self._args, function = xmlrpclib.loads(lines) The fix was proposed by jens Klein, see https://bugs.launchpad.net/zope3/+bug/283089/comments/3 If noone objects i will add it to the zope.publisher 3.4 branch and make a release (3.4.8). The fix is needed at least for Grok to make XMLRPC work with paster.httpserver. Re: [Zope] psycopg version mismatch (imported 2.0.6 (dec mx dt ext pq3))
-BEGIN PGP SIGNED MESSAGE- Hash: SHA1 amol kumbhar wrote: Hi I am using zope 2.10 , python2.4 and psycopg2-2.0.9 . I had created entry in ZIM successfully but while connecting to db it is giving me following error. Please pull me out from this ASAP. An error was encountered while publishing this resource. Error Type: ImportError Error Value: psycopg version mismatch (imported 2.0.6 (dec mx dt ext pq3)) Look at ZPsycopgDA/DA.py Edit the list in ALLOWED_PSYCOPG_VERSIONS to match your installed psycopg version. [Zope] Re: Help me some error when I complie Zope!
Duc Toan schrieb: I'm using WindowsXP, Python 2.4.3, Visual Studio 2005. When I complie Zope 2.9.6 from source, it alway alert: running build_ext creating zope.proxy copying zope/proxy\proxy.h - zope.proxy error: The .NET Framework SDK needs to be installed before building extensions for Python. NMAKE : fatal error U1077: 'C:\Python24\python.exe' : return code '0x1' Stop. Somebody help me solve this problem. Don't say me install .NET Framework, because I installed VS2005 include .NET Framework(I think so) The Windows Python binary (2.4 and 2.5) is built with Visual Studio 2003, compiling Zope needs the same compiler. The free VisualC++ Toolkit 2003 is not available for download anymore since mid 2006, its been replaced by the free Visual Studio 2005 Express. What you can do without further problems is: install cygwin (or MingW), compile Python from source with cygwin, finally compile Zope from source under cygwin. This is atm also the only way to get Python eggs with C extensions compiled under Windows. [Zope-dev] Alternative to reload()
Sorry for the crosspost, i think it is of interest to both zope-dev and zope3-dev. Guido van Rossum on Edu-sig mailing list just posted some code to reload a module in place, updating classes, methods and functions. [Edu-sig] Reloading code (was Re: OLPC: first thoughts) http://mail.python.org/pipermail/edu-sig/2007-February/007787.html Alternative to reload(). This works by executing the module in a scratch namespace, and then patching classes, methods and functions. This avoids the need to patch instances. New objects are copied into the target namespace. [Zope] Re: How to do this trick..
Jason C. Leach wrote: Hi, I'm wondering how I can do this little trick (sp_info is a globaly devide var, it's a dictionary obj): option tal:repeat=group groups/existing/high tal:content=group tal:attributes=onmouseover string:doTooltip(event, '${sp_info/${group}/common_name}') onmouseout=hideTip() /option So based on my the value of 'group' from my repeat, I want to use the value to look up another value in a different dictionary. It works if I do this: (event, '${sp_info/whatever/common_name}') but does not like me using the embedded ${group}. You can insert the value of a dynamically named variable using the '?' specifier:: tal:attributes=onmouseover string:doTooltip(event, '${sp_info/?group/common_name}') should do the trick. This only works inside path expressions.
